终极OneDrive卸载完全指南:5大步骤解决顽固残留问题
当你发现系统中OneDrive图标反复出现、后台进程占用资源,即使尝试常规卸载也无法彻底清除时,你需要的不是简单的程序删除,而是一套专业的系统清理方案。本文将通过五阶段流程,帮助你彻底摆脱OneDrive的困扰,恢复系统纯净状态。
问题现象排查:OneDrive残留的典型表现
当你尝试卸载OneDrive后遇到以下情况,说明系统中存在顽固残留:
- 资源管理器左侧仍显示OneDrive文件夹图标
- 任务管理器中出现OneDrive相关进程(如OneDrive.exe、OneDriveSetup.exe)
- 系统启动时间明显延长,开机后出现"正在配置OneDrive"提示
- 磁盘空间未完全释放,仍有不明占用
▶️ 残留类型分析
- 程序文件残留:安装目录未完全删除
- 注册表项残留:系统配置信息未清理
- 启动项残留:隐藏在系统启动配置中的自动运行条目
- 用户数据残留:AppData和用户配置文件中的缓存数据
成因深度分析:为什么OneDrive难以彻底删除
OneDrive作为微软生态的核心组件,采用了多层次系统集成设计,这使得常规卸载无法完全清除其所有组件:
- 进程保护机制:OneDrive使用多重进程守护,普通任务管理器难以终止所有相关进程
- 系统深度整合:与Windows文件资源管理器深度绑定,形成特殊的命名空间扩展
- 权限设计:部分核心文件和注册表项受系统保护,普通用户权限无法删除
- 更新机制:Windows Update可能重新安装OneDrive核心组件
▶️ 技术原理解析 OneDrive在系统中创建了特殊的CLSID注册表项({018D5C66-4533-4307-9B53-224DE2ED1FE6}),用于在文件资源管理器中显示其图标和功能。即使主程序被卸载,这些注册表项仍可能保留,导致残留现象。
分级解决方案实施:从基础到深度的清理流程
A级清理:标准卸载流程(适合普通用户)
- 按下Win+R,输入
appwiz.cpl打开程序和功能 - 在列表中找到"Microsoft OneDrive",右键选择卸载
- 按照卸载向导完成基本卸载
- 重启计算机
注意:此步骤仅移除主程序文件,不会清理用户数据和注册表项
实施难度评估:★☆☆☆☆
B级清理:文件与注册表手动清理(适合进阶用户)
-
终止所有OneDrive进程
- 打开任务管理器(Ctrl+Shift+Esc)
- 结束所有名称包含"OneDrive"的进程
-
删除残留文件目录
%UserProfile%\OneDrive %LocalAppData%\Microsoft\OneDrive %ProgramData%\Microsoft OneDrive C:\OneDriveTemp -
清理注册表项
- 按下Win+R,输入
regedit打开注册表编辑器 - 删除以下路径:
HKEY_CLASSES_ROOT\CLSID\{018D5C66-4533-4307-9B53-224DE2ED1FE6} HKEY_CLASSES_ROOT\Wow6432Node\CLSID\{018D5C66-4533-4307-9B53-224DE2ED1FE6}
- 按下Win+R,输入
注意:修改注册表前请导出备份,错误操作可能导致系统不稳定
实施难度评估:★★★☆☆
C级清理:专业批处理工具(适合所有用户)
-
获取OneDrive Uninstaller工具
- 从项目仓库克隆:
git clone https://gitcode.com/gh_mirrors/one/OneDrive-Uninstaller - 选择最新版本批处理文件(如"OneDrive Uninstaller v1.4.bat")
- 从项目仓库克隆:
-
以管理员身份运行
- 右键点击批处理文件
- 选择"以管理员身份运行"
-
确认操作
- 阅读警告信息
- 输入"Y"并按回车继续
-
等待完成
- 工具将自动处理:终止进程→卸载程序→清理文件→删除注册表项
- 出现"OneDrive Uninstall and cleaning completed"提示即表示成功
注意:过程中可能出现"访问被拒绝"错误,此时需要重启电脑后再次运行工具
实施难度评估:★★☆☆☆
效果验证方法:残留清除确认与系统检查
完成清理后,通过以下方法验证效果:
基础验证
- 重启电脑后检查任务管理器,确认无OneDrive相关进程
- 打开文件资源管理器,验证左侧导航栏中OneDrive图标已消失
- 检查控制面板"程序和功能",确认OneDrive不在列表中
深度验证
-
检查残留文件
dir %UserProfile%\OneDrive /b (应返回"找不到文件") dir %LocalAppData%\Microsoft\OneDrive /b (应返回"找不到文件") -
注册表检查
- 打开注册表编辑器
- 搜索
{018D5C66-4533-4307-9B53-224DE2ED1FE6} - 确认无相关项存在
性能对比
| 性能指标 | 清理前状态 | 清理后状态 | 用户场景差异 |
|---|---|---|---|
| 内存占用 | 150-250MB | 0MB | 企业用户:多账户配置节省更多资源 |
| 启动时间 | 延长10-15秒 | 恢复正常 | 个人用户:启动速度提升更明显 |
| 磁盘空间 | 占用1-3GB | 完全释放 | 存储敏感用户:空间回收效果显著 |
| 系统稳定性 | 偶发资源冲突 | 冲突消除 | 开发环境:减少进程干扰提高工作效率 |
长效维护策略:防止OneDrive自动恢复
系统级防护
-
禁用OneDrive自动安装
- 按下Win+R,输入
gpedit.msc打开组策略编辑器 - 导航至"计算机配置→管理模板→Windows组件→OneDrive"
- 启用"阻止使用OneDrive进行文件存储"策略
- 按下Win+R,输入
-
Windows Update设置
- 打开"设置→更新和安全→高级选项"
- 关闭"接收其他Microsoft产品的更新"
定期维护计划
-
每周执行系统清理
- 使用磁盘清理工具清除临时文件
- 检查启动项确保无OneDrive相关条目
-
每月深度检查
- 运行批处理工具进行二次清理
- 检查注册表项确认无残留
▶️ 专业建议 对于企业环境,建议通过组策略统一部署OneDrive卸载和禁用策略;家庭用户可创建计划任务,定期运行清理脚本,防止系统更新后OneDrive组件被自动恢复。
通过以上系统化的清理方案,你不仅能彻底移除OneDrive的所有组件,还能建立长期防护机制,确保系统保持最佳性能状态。记住,真正的系统优化需要不仅是一次性的清理,而是持续的维护和监控。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0225-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01- IinulaInula(发音为:[ˈɪnjʊlə])意为旋覆花,有生命力旺盛和根系深厚两大特点,寓意着为前端生态提供稳固的基石。openInula 是一款用于构建用户界面的 JavaScript 库,提供响应式 API 帮助开发者简单高效构建 web 页面,比传统虚拟 DOM 方式渲染效率提升30%以上,同时 openInula 提供与 React 保持一致的 API,并且提供5大常用功能丰富的核心组件。TypeScript05